Herniated Discs



Herniated discs are a typical spinal condition that frequently results in surgical intervention when traditional therapies stop working. This problem takes place when the soft inner gel of a spinal disc protrudes through a tear in the harder external layer, possibly compressing neighboring nerves. Signs and symptoms commonly consist of localized discomfort, emitting discomfort in the arm or legs, and neurological shortages such as prickling or weakness.

Medical diagnosis generally entails a combination of checkups, individual history, and imaging studies such as MRI or CT checks. Conservative treatment alternatives typically consist of physical therapy, pain monitoring, and lifestyle alterations. When these strategies fail to supply alleviation after a specified period, surgical choices such as discectomy or back fusion might be considered.


Surgery intends to alleviate discomfort and recover function by getting rid of the herniated part of the disc or stabilizing the affected spinal section. While several clients experience substantial enhancement following surgical procedure, it is vital to weigh the advantages and dangers in appointment with a qualified spinal column professional. Ultimately, timely intervention is important to prevent additional complications and enhance lifestyle for people enduring from this devastating problem.


Spinal Stenosis



Experiencing spinal stenosis can substantially affect a person's wheelchair and lifestyle. This problem happens when the spine canal narrows, putting pressure on the spinal cord and nerves. Commonly seen in the lumbar (reduced back) and cervical (neck) areas, spinal stenosis frequently results from degenerative changes connected with aging, such as joint inflammation, disc herniation, or enlarging of tendons.


Signs of spinal constriction can differ, but they generally consist of discomfort, tingling, tingling, and weak point in the extremities. These signs and symptoms may worsen with activity or extended standing and commonly enhance with rest. In extreme situations, individuals might experience problems with equilibrium and sychronisation, resulting in a heightened threat of falls.


When traditional therapies, such as physical therapy, drugs, and way of life alterations, stop working to reduce symptoms, medical intervention might be thought about. Treatments like laminectomy or spine fusion goal to decompress the damaged nerves and stabilize the back. Early diagnosis and therapy are important in managing spine stenosis successfully and preserving wheelchair, ultimately boosting the client's total high quality of life.


Spondylolisthesis



Spondylolisthesis occurs when one vertebra slides forward over the one below it, possibly leading to spine instability and nerve compression. This condition can arise from numerous elements, including congenital issues, degenerative modifications, trauma, or recurring anxiety injuries. Symptoms commonly include reduced neck and back pain, rigidity, and emitting discomfort in the legs, which can dramatically affect daily tasks and total lifestyle.


Medical diagnosis usually entails a thorough scientific evaluation, imaging research studies such as X-rays or MRI, and assessment of neurological feature. The level of slippage is classified into grades, with higher grades suggesting a lot more extreme variation and a better likelihood of surgical intervention.

Conservative treatment choices might consist of physical treatment, discomfort administration, and task modification. Nonetheless, when these procedures fail to relieve signs or when neurological deficits arise, operations might be required. Common medical options consist of spinal combination, which stabilizes the afflicted vertebrae, and decompression surgery to alleviate nerve pressure.


Very early medical diagnosis and ideal management are essential in stopping additional issues and boosting patient end results. As spondylolisthesis can bring about chronic discomfort and disability, prompt intervention is essential for bring back spinal health and wellness.


Degenerative Disc Illness



Degenerative Disc Disease (DDD) is a condition characterized by the progressive damage of the intervertebral discs, which work as essential shock absorbers in between the vertebrae of the back. As these discs lose hydration and flexibility in time, they end up being much less efficient at cushioning the vertebrae, resulting in raised friction and anxiety on the spine frameworks.

The condition can additionally result in nerve compression if the degenerated discs lump or herniate, resulting in radicular discomfort, weakness, or pins and needles in the limbs


Medical diagnosis commonly involves a combination of health examinations, imaging research studies like MRI or CT checks, and individual background to assess the seriousness of disc degeneration and its influence on everyday tasks. Treatment alternatives range from conventional steps, consisting of physical therapy and pain management, to even more invasive treatments when conservative actions stop working. Surgical treatments, such as spine fusion or man-made disc replacement, may be shown for patients with significant pain and useful problems. Generally, early intervention and tailored management strategies are important for alleviating the results of DDD and boosting client results.
